Marvel Tōkon: Fighting Souls Sold 485,000 Units in First Week, 74 Percent of Sales on PS5 – Rumor
SHARE

It’s been ten days since Marvel Tōkon: Fighting Souls was released, and the buzz is decidedly more muted than before launch. Much of that is due to issues with the PC version which, despite a recent patch, still has a “Mixed” rating on Steam with only 48 percent of user reviews recommending it.

However, it seems that its sales haven’t been too crazy either. Alinea Analytics’ Rhys Elliott estimates that 485,000 copies were sold on PS5 and PC in the first week, apparently resulting in $33 million in revenue. Unsurprisingly, 74 percent of copies sold were reportedly on PS5, while Steam contributed only 26 percent.

Interestingly, PlayStation may have other Marvel titles to thank for the response, as Elliott reports significant crossover with Marvel’s Spider-Man: Miles Morales and Spider-Man 2 (though Marvel Rivals also figured into the equation). Dragon Ball FighterZ, ArcSys’s best-selling fighting game to date, apparently had significant overlap, though fans of Street Fighter 6 and Mortal Kombat 1 also reportedly showed up.

Of course, the sentiment is that Tōkon could have reached one million sales if the PC version fared better. As such, the developer is committed to addressing issues and long-term support with new characters (with the first DLC character, Phoenix Cyclops, out in Fall), so we’ll see if it can pick up over time.
